#e42658 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e42658 is composed of 89.4% red, 14.9%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 83.3% magenta, 61.4%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 344.2 degrees, a saturation of 77.9% and a lightness of 52.2%. #e42658 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4cb0 with #c90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3366.

Shades and Tints of #e42658

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0103 is the darkest color, while #fef7f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e42658

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#868484 is the less saturated color, while #f7134f is the most saturated one.
